Unleash Your Vision with the Nikon D780

The Nikon D780 is a versatile FX-format DSLR designed to capture stunning photos and videos. It blends the robustness of a traditional DSLR with advanced live view features, inherited from Nikon's flagship cameras, to provide exceptional performance in any shooting scenario. Paired with the AF-S NIKKOR 24-120mm f/4G ED VR lens, this kit offers outstanding image quality and versatility.

Key Features:

  • Sharp, reliable subject acquisition with an advanced 51-point AF system.
  • First Nikon DSLR with focal-plane phase-detection AF for enhanced live view performance.
  • Eye-detection AF for captivating portraits.
  • 24.5MP FX-format backside-illuminated CMOS sensor.
  • Extensive shutter speed range: 1/8000 to 900 seconds.
  • In-camera time-lapse movie creation.
  • Long battery life: approximately 2,260 shots per charge.
  • Vast creative options with NIKKOR F lenses.
  • 4K UHD/30p video with HDR (HLG) support and Full HD/120p slow-motion recording.

Specifications:

  • Image Sensor: 24.5MP backside illuminated FX full frame CMOS
  • Autofocus System: 51-point AF (viewfinder), 273-point phase-detection AF (live view)
  • Continuous Shooting: 7 fps (viewfinder), 12 fps (live view, electronic shutter)
  • Video Recording: 4K UHD up to 30p, Full HD up to 120p
  • ISO Range: 100-51200
  • Shutter Speed: 1/8000 to 900 seconds
  • Battery Life: Approx. 2,260 shots (CIPA standard)

Key Features

24.5MP backside illuminated FX full frame image sensor, capable of remarkable light gathering for highly detailed photos and 4K UHD videos with ultra shallow depth of field and sharp, clean low light shots.

Dual Autofocus system: 51-point AF for capturing photos using the viewfinder; 273-point phase-detection AF for capturing photos and videos using the touchscreen LCD.

7 frames per second continuous shooting or switch to live view mode for 12 frames per second silent shooting using the electronic shutter.

Nikon's most robust DSLR for video capture: Hybrid PDAF system, ful frame 4K UHD, slow motion at 1080 / 120p, in-camera time-lapse, 10-bit HDMI output, N-Log, HDR (HLG), highlight monitoring (zebra stripes) and built-in timecode.

Tilting touchscreen LCD makes it easy to get the shot, even from high or low angles and allows for tap focusing, tap shutter release, swiping and zooming images in playback and easy menu navigation.

Wireless connectivity with the easy to use SnapBridge app

Shutter speeds as slow as 900 seconds without the need for a remote, great for long exposures and astrophotography.

Robust set of creative features, including 20 unique, high quality Creative Picture Controls, 10 special effect modes, multiple exposure options and focus shift photography (for creating focus stacked images).

Long battery life up to 2,260 shots per charge (according to CIPA testing).
